The final installment of the acclaimed "Seven Sisters" series. Paris, 1928. A boy is discovered just in time before he dies and is taken in by a family. He is clever and lovable, and he develops his talents in his new home. Here, he is given a life he never dared to dream of. Yet, he refuses to give any hint about who he really is. As he grows into a young man, he falls in love and attends the famous Paris Conservatory. He can almost forget the horrors of his past, as well as the promise he once made to fulfill. But disaster looms over Europe, and no one is safe anymore. Deep in his heart, he knows that the time will come when he must flee again. Aegean Sea, 2008. All seven sisters have gathered aboard the "Titan" to say goodbye to their beloved father, who always remained a mystery to them. To everyone's surprise, it is the missing sister who has been entrusted by Pa Salt to show them the way to their past. But for every truth that is revealed, a new question arises, and the sisters must realize that they hardly knew their father at all. Even more shocking is that these long-buried secrets still have repercussions on all their lives. "Atlas. The Story of Pa Salt" tells of a life full of love and loss, spanning seas and continents, and brings the "Seven Sisters" series to a breathtaking conclusion. Harry Whittaker is Lucinda Riley's son, to whom she entrusted the story of "Atlas" before her death, so that he could bring it to a close according to her vision.
